SqlServerIndexExtensions Klasse

Definition

Indexerweiterungsmethoden für SQL Server-spezifische Metadaten.

public static class SqlServerIndexExtensions
type SqlServerIndexExtensions = class
Public Module SqlServerIndexExtensions
Vererbung
SqlServerIndexExtensions

Hinweise

Weitere Informationen und Beispiele finden Sie unter Modellieren von Entitätstypen und Beziehungen und Zugreifen auf SQL Server und Azure SQL Datenbanken mit EF Core.

Methoden

GetDataCompression(IReadOnlyIndex)

Gibt die Datenkomprimierung zurück, die der Index verwendet.

GetDataCompression(IReadOnlyIndex, StoreObjectIdentifier)

Gibt die Datenkomprimierung zurück, die der Index verwendet.

GetDataCompressionConfigurationSource(IConventionIndex)

Gibt den ConfigurationSource für die Vom Index verwendete Datenkomprimierung zurück.

GetFillFactor(IIndex)

Gibt einen Wert zurück, der angibt, ob der Index den Füllfaktor verwendet.

GetFillFactor(IReadOnlyIndex)

Gibt den Füllfaktor zurück, den der Index verwendet.

GetFillFactor(IReadOnlyIndex, StoreObjectIdentifier)

Gibt den Füllfaktor zurück, den der Index verwendet.

GetFillFactorConfigurationSource(IConventionIndex)

Gibt zurück, ConfigurationSource ob der Index den Füllfaktor verwendet.

GetIncludeProperties(IIndex)

Gibt enthaltene Eigenschaftsnamen zurück, oder null , wenn sie nicht angegeben wurden.

GetIncludeProperties(IReadOnlyIndex)

Gibt enthaltene Eigenschaftsnamen zurück, oder null , wenn sie nicht angegeben wurden.

GetIncludeProperties(IReadOnlyIndex, StoreObjectIdentifier)

Gibt enthaltene Eigenschaftsnamen zurück, oder null , wenn sie nicht angegeben wurden.

GetIncludePropertiesConfigurationSource(IConventionIndex)

Gibt den ConfigurationSource für die eingeschlossenen Eigenschaftennamen zurück.

GetIsClusteredConfigurationSource(IConventionIndex)

Gibt zurück, ConfigurationSource ob der Index gruppiert ist.

GetIsCreatedOnlineConfigurationSource(IConventionIndex)

Gibt zurück, ConfigurationSource ob der Index online ist.

GetSortInTempDb(IReadOnlyIndex)

Gibt einen Wert zurück, der angibt, ob der Index in tempdb sortiert ist.

GetSortInTempDb(IReadOnlyIndex, StoreObjectIdentifier)

Gibt einen Wert zurück, der angibt, ob der Index in tempdb sortiert ist.

GetSortInTempDbConfigurationSource(IConventionIndex)

Gibt zurück, ConfigurationSource ob der Index in tempdb sortiert ist.

IsClustered(IIndex)

Gibt einen Wert zurück, der angibt, ob der Index gruppiert ist.

IsClustered(IIndex, StoreObjectIdentifier)

Gibt einen Wert zurück, der angibt, ob der Index gruppiert ist.

IsClustered(IReadOnlyIndex)

Gibt einen Wert zurück, der angibt, ob der Index gruppiert ist.

IsClustered(IReadOnlyIndex, StoreObjectIdentifier)

Gibt einen Wert zurück, der angibt, ob der Index gruppiert ist.

IsCreatedOnline(IIndex)

Gibt einen Wert zurück, der angibt, ob der Index online ist.

IsCreatedOnline(IReadOnlyIndex)

Gibt einen Wert zurück, der angibt, ob der Index online ist.

IsCreatedOnline(IReadOnlyIndex, StoreObjectIdentifier)

Gibt einen Wert zurück, der angibt, ob der Index online ist.

SetDataCompression(IConventionIndex, Nullable<DataCompressionType>, Boolean)

Legt einen Wert fest, der die Vom Index verwendete Datenkomprimierung angibt.

SetDataCompression(IMutableIndex, Nullable<DataCompressionType>)

Legt einen Wert fest, der die Vom Index verwendete Datenkomprimierung angibt.

SetFillFactor(IConventionIndex, Nullable<Int32>, Boolean)

Definiert einen Wert, der angibt, ob der Index den Füllfaktor verwendet.

SetFillFactor(IMutableIndex, Nullable<Int32>)

Legt einen Wert fest, der angibt, ob der Index den Füllfaktor verwendet.

SetIncludeProperties(IConventionIndex, IReadOnlyList<String>, Boolean)

Legt eingeschlossene Eigenschaftsnamen fest.

SetIncludeProperties(IMutableIndex, IReadOnlyList<String>)

Legt eingeschlossene Eigenschaftsnamen fest.

SetIsClustered(IConventionIndex, Nullable<Boolean>, Boolean)

Legt einen Wert fest, der angibt, ob der Index gruppiert ist.

SetIsClustered(IMutableIndex, Nullable<Boolean>)

Legt einen Wert fest, der angibt, ob der Index gruppiert ist.

SetIsCreatedOnline(IConventionIndex, Nullable<Boolean>, Boolean)

Legt einen Wert fest, der angibt, ob der Index online ist.

SetIsCreatedOnline(IMutableIndex, Nullable<Boolean>)

Legt einen Wert fest, der angibt, ob der Index online ist.

SetSortInTempDb(IConventionIndex, Nullable<Boolean>, Boolean)

Legt einen Wert fest, der angibt, ob der Index in tempdb sortiert ist.

SetSortInTempDb(IMutableIndex, Nullable<Boolean>)

Legt einen Wert fest, der angibt, ob der Index in tempdb sortiert ist.

Gilt für: